The Analysis Of Urban Road Network Vulnerability Considering The Effect Of Congestion

Since urban road network is the important carrier of urban traffic activities, more and more scholars are interested in the study of the network's vulnerability. In this paper, we consider the congestion effect in the process of urban road traffic network vulnerability analysis, during which we analyze the congestion in the network at the same time. So we can reduce the vulnerability of network by easing and controlling the traffic pressure.Firstly, how to construct the urban road network topology is expounded in this paper. In this paper, we use the Original Method to build the topology of urban road network. Then we expound the concept, connotation and the impact factors of urban road network vulnerability, analyze urban road network vulnerability from state vulnerability and structural vulnerability, which are very important for later vulnerability analysis process. Secondly, this paper is mainly about the change of the vulnerability and congestion degree in the urban road network during the cascading failure, which is caused by the failure of one road due to road congestion. To finish these works, we build the static and the dynamic mitigation models. In addition to this, we introduce the congestion factor. Thirdly, we consider the possibility of the key road to become congested. Then we consider that if the influence to network vulnerability is different when the cascading failure is caused by the key road and the non-critical road. Beyond that, we try to find the relationship between vulnerability and congestion. Finally, we proposed the methods to alleviate congestion to reduce the vulnerability: increased the design capacity, the distribution of spare capacity based on the importance of the roads and the regional one-way traffic Settings. We explore the relationships between the vulnerability and the degree of congestion of the network by analyzing the process of cascading failures in the transformation of road network and the original road network. And then we find that the three methods all above can reduce the network congestion degree and vulnerability to a certain extent.In this paper, we consider the change of the vulnerability and congestion degree in the urban road network during the cascading failure, which is caused by the failure of one road due to road congestion. We propose the methods to reduce the vulnerability of network by easing the traffic pressure. The methods are feasible, which can provide certain guidance for the management.
